Chapter 11 - Vectors and Vector-Valued Functions - 11.1 Vectors in the Plane - 11.1 Exercises - Page 768: 37

Answer

$\sqrt{194}$

Work Step by Step

We are given: $u=(3,-4)$ $v=(1,1)$ $w=(-1,0)$ Determine $|2u+3v-4w|$: $|2u+3v-4w|=|2(3,-4)+3(1,1)-4(-1,0)|=|(6,8)+(3,3)+(4,0)|=|(6+3+4,-8+3+0|=|(13,-5)|=\sqrt{13^2+(-5)^2}=\sqrt{194}$
